The Cord Coiled EV Charging Cable is designed for electric and hybrid vehicle owners seeking a durable, tangle-free, and convenient charging solution. Its key benefit is a space-saving coiled design that prevents mess and wear, coupled with robust weather resistance. A potential caveat is its standard 7.4kW charging speed, which is suitable for overnight or longer top-ups but may not be the fastest option for users needing rapid charging. This cable supports 7.4kW (32A, 230V) charging, is compatible with all Type 2 EVs since 2018, and offers features like IP65 waterproofing and IK10 impact resistance for reliable performance in various conditions.

What is the maximum charging speed of this cable?

This Cord Coiled EV Charging Cable supports a maximum charging speed of 7.4kW (32A, 230V) on a single-phase connection.

Is this cable compatible with all electric cars?

It is compatible with most electric vehicles and plug-in hybrid electric vehicles that have a Type 2 charging port, which is standard on models manufactured in Europe since 2018.

How do I clean the charging cable?

You can clean the cable with a damp cloth. Ensure the connectors are dry before use.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ials.

What does the coiled design offer?

The coiled design keeps the cable neatly organized, prevents it from dragging on the ground, reduces tangles, and makes storage much simpler and more convenient.

Can this cable be used outdoors in the rain?

Yes, the cable features IP65 waterproofing, making it safe to use in various weather conditions, including rain.

Troubleshooting

Cable not charging the vehicle.

Ensure both ends of the cable are securely connected. Check that the vehicle and charging station are powered on and communicating. Verify compatibility with your vehicle's Type 2 port. Inspect the cable and connectors for any visible damage.

Charging speed is slower than expected.

Confirm that the charging station supports 7.4kW charging. Check your vehicle's charging settings, as some may limit charging speed. Ensure the cable is not damaged and connections are firm.

Error message on vehicle or charging station.

Refer to your vehicle's manual or the charging station's documentation for specific error code meanings. Try unplugging and replugging the cable. If the issue persists, contact customer support.

Cable appears damaged.

Do not use the cable if you notice any cuts, fraying, or damage to the insulation or connectors. Contact the manufacturer or retailer for a replacement.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

Setup:

  1. Ensure the charging point or power source has a compatible Type 2 socket.
  2. Uncoil the charging cable to the desired length.
  3. Plug the Type 2 connector firmly into your electric vehicle's charging port.
  4. Connect the other end to the charging station or power outlet.
  5. Initiate charging via your vehicle or the charging station's controls.

Compatibility:

  • This cable is designed for electric vehicles (EVs) and pl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EVs) equipped with a Type 2 charging port. This is standard on most EVs manufactured in Europe since 2018.
  • It supports single-phase charging at 230V and 32A, delivering up to 7.4kW.

Care:

  • After use, allow the cable to cool if it feels warm.
  • Gently guide the cable back into its coiled form, avoiding sharp bends or kinks.
  • Store the cable in a clean, dry place, away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ures when not in use.
  • Periodically inspect the connectors and cable for any signs of damage, wear, or debris. Clean connectors with a dry, lint-free cloth if necessary.
  • Avoid dragging the coiled cable excessively on rough surfaces, even though it's designed to minimize ground contact.
